Poetry about Monsters : post Tennyson�s Kraken
After reading the Kraken or similar poems, students can come up with ideas to write their own in groups using this sheet (copied onto A3 size) as a brainstorming activity. Display around the class and ask students for feedback and ideas. Get them to write it and post it around class. Students share and then write in groups/individually.

Solutions Matching Exercise
This is useful because you can cut it up and glue them onto cards and then get students to play a fast game of cards in groups - deal the cards, then get students to pick any at random from their partners. When they get a match, they put the set down. First one who finishes wins. You can display the answers on the board.
